Is Lit harder than Lang?

In AP Lit, you are expected to read more. You read more novels and plays. Additionally, you have to read, understand, and analyze poetry. The complexity level of what you are reading is also usually higher in AP Lit than AP Lang, and you are asked to go more in-depth in terms of analysis.

Are linguistics worth studying?

Linguistics is a major that provides insight into one of the most intriguing aspects of human knowledge and behavior. Majoring in linguistics means learning about many aspects of human language, including sounds (phonetics, phonology), words (morphology), sentences (syntax), and meaning (semantics).

What happens if you pass English Literature but fail English Language?

According to the government, you don't need to resit your English language GCSE if you've passed English literature. So, if you've got one of your English GCSEs, you don't need to worry about the other one. As long as you get a grade 4 in one of those subjects, you're fine. You only need to resit if you've failed both.

What's the difference between English lit and Lang?

English literature is more concerned with the thematic content of texts and typically involves poetry, prose and larger bodies of work. English language Is more scientific in nature and looks at language in segments E.g. Syntax, Morphology, Phonology.
